GINGER SHRIMP Recipe

Ingredients:

12 Raw, Jumbo Shrimp, Peeled, De-veined and Butterflied
1 T Soy Sauce
2 T Honey
3 T Olive Oil
3 T Fresh, Grated Ginger

Directions:

Combine all ingredients, except for the shrimp, in a frying pan and heat to high. Add shrimp and coat with sauce. Reduce heat to medium. Sauce will thicken and glaze shrimp. Shrimp is done when it is light pink.

Serve as an appetizer or main course. Drizzle sauce over shrimp. Garnish with thinly sliced carrot and scallions. Great with risotto!
